The Finnish women's team beat Sweden, Czech Republic and Russia to win the first tournament of the season.
Finland played three close games in Hodonin, Czech Republic and managed to win all three. In the opening game on Thursday Sweden was beaten in overtime. Minnamarie Tuominen scored the game-winning 2-1 goal. Sweden took an early lead and Finland tied it only two minutes from the end on a goal by Susanna Tapani.
In the second game finland beat the home team Czech Republic 3-2 with goals from Linda Välimäki, Elisa Holopainen and Riikka Välilä. Today Finland beat Russia 3-1. All goals were scored in the middle period. Jenni Hiirikoski scored twice and Riikka Välilä also got a goal in this game.
Sweden finished second after today's 4-2 win over the Czechs. Czech Republic finished third and Russia 4th - both with three points.
Top scorer of the tournament was Katerina Mrazova of the home team with three goals and three assists. Team-mate Aneta Ledlova also got three goals and so did Swedish 16-year-old talent Lina Ljungblom.
